从零开始搭建VPS+VPN,网络自由与安全的终极指南

banxian11 2026-05-11 半仙加速器 11 0

在当今高度互联的世界中,隐私保护和网络自由已成为每个用户不可忽视的重要议题,无论是远程办公、访问受限内容,还是保护家庭网络免受窥探,使用VPS(虚拟专用服务器)结合VPN(虚拟私人网络)已成为许多技术爱好者和专业人士的首选方案,本文将为你详细讲解如何从零开始搭建一套稳定、安全且可自定义的VPS+VPN系统,帮助你掌控自己的网络环境。

第一步:选择合适的VPS服务商
要搭建自己的VPN服务,首先需要一台稳定的VPS服务器,推荐使用如DigitalOcean、Linode或AWS等主流平台,这些服务商提供全球多地的数据中心选项,支持Linux操作系统(如Ubuntu 22.04 LTS),并具备良好的性价比和稳定性,注册账号后,创建一个基础实例,建议配置至少1核CPU、1GB内存和25GB SSD存储空间,这足以应对大多数个人用户的并发连接需求。

第二步:部署OpenVPN或WireGuard
OpenVPN是老牌且成熟的开源协议,兼容性强;而WireGuard则是新一代轻量级协议,性能更优、加密更强,对于新手,推荐先从OpenVPN入手,安装过程如下:

  1. 登录你的VPS(使用SSH工具如PuTTY或Terminal);
  2. 更新系统:sudo apt update && sudo apt upgrade -y
  3. 安装OpenVPN:sudo apt install openvpn easy-rsa -y
  4. 使用Easy-RSA生成证书和密钥(这是SSL/TLS认证的核心);
  5. 配置服务器端文件(如/etc/openvpn/server.conf),设置端口(如UDP 1194)、IP段(如10.8.0.0/24)和DNS(如8.8.8.8);
  6. 启动服务:sudo systemctl enable openvpn@serversudo systemctl start openvpn@server

第三步:客户端配置与连接
为手机、电脑或路由器生成客户端配置文件(.ovpn),并将证书和密钥打包发送到设备上,以Windows为例,下载OpenVPN GUI客户端,导入配置文件即可一键连接,首次连接时可能需要管理员权限,之后会自动保存登录状态。

第四步:增强安全性
为了防止暴力破解和DDoS攻击,建议:

  • 更改默认端口(例如改为53333);
  • 使用Fail2Ban监控日志并封禁异常IP;
  • 启用防火墙(UFW)限制仅允许特定端口通信;
  • 定期更新服务器系统和OpenVPN版本。

第五步:可选优化——使用Cloudflare Tunnel或Nginx反向代理
如果你希望隐藏VPS的真实IP地址,可以借助Cloudflare的免费隧道服务,将流量通过其CDN节点转发,实现“隐身”效果,这不仅能提升隐私,还能缓解带宽压力。


通过以上步骤,你已成功构建了一套基于VPS的自托管VPN服务,相比第三方付费服务,这种方式成本低、控制权高,适合追求技术自主性和数据隐私的用户,合法合规使用是前提——请确保你的行为符合所在国家/地区的法律法规,随着技术进步,未来还可以集成自动化运维脚本(如Ansible)、容器化部署(Docker)甚至AI日志分析,进一步提升效率和可靠性,现在就开始动手吧,让网络世界真正属于你自己!

从零开始搭建VPS+VPN,网络自由与安全的终极指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速